TESLA Liptovský Hrádok (Slovakia) supplied a battery storage system with a capacity of 1118 kWh and a power of 550 kW to the Okoličné small hydropower plant in Liptovský Mikuláš, Slovakia. More information about this battery storage system can be found on the TESLA Energy Group website.
The control system supplier was ALTRON, a.s., for which our company REX Controls s.r.o. developed and deployed the control algorithms and local Human-Machine Interface (HMI) based on the REXYGEN system running on Altrix control units. ALTRON developed data archiving using the Telegraf system by InfluxData and visualisation of this data in Grafana.
The control system integrates the operation of numerous devices, most of which communicate via the Modbus Master TCP or RTU protocol, and provides data to the Battery Management System (BMS) via the Modbus TCP Slave protocol. In addition, the system reads direct digital inputs and sets digital outputs on the Altrix control unit. The control system manages the battery temperatures by controlling the cooling water temperature, charging and discharging of the batteries, ensures compliance with maximum charge and discharge power limits, evaluates fault conditions of individual devices, communicates with the supervisory BMS, and controls the equipment of the battery storage according to its commands.
